Emergency First Aid Measures

Critical first aid procedures for chemical exposure incidents and medical emergencies

🫁 Inhalation Exposure

Move to fresh air

Symptoms:

Not classified. Inhalation of vapors in high concentration may cause irritation of respiratory system.

πŸ–οΈ Skin Contact

Remove contaminated clothing and shoes. Wash off with soap and water. Wash contaminated clothing before reuse.

Symptoms:

Not classified. May produce an allergic reaction.

πŸ‘οΈ Eye Contact

Rinse thoroughly with plenty of water, also under the eyelids.

Symptoms:

Not classified.

🍽️ Ingestion/Swallowing

Do NOT induce vomiting. Never give anything by mouth to an unconscious person. Call a physician or Poison Control Center immediately.

Symptoms:

Not classified. Ingestion may cause gastrointestinal irritation, nausea, vomiting and diarrhea.

🚨 Immediate Medical Attention Required

Treat symptomatically

Exposure Controls & Personal Protective Equipment (PPE)

Occupational exposure limits, engineering controls, and required safety equipment

🏭 Engineering Controls

Apply technical measures to comply with the occupational exposure limits. When working in confined spaces (tanks, containers, etc.), ensure that there is a supply of air suitable for breathing and wear the recommended equipment.

🧀 Hand Protection

Hydrocarbon-proof gloves, Nitrile rubber, Fluorinated rubber. Please observe the instructions regarding permeability and breakthrough time which are provided by the supplier of the gloves. Also take into consideration the specific local conditions under which the product is used, such as the danger of cuts, abrasion. If used in solution, or mixed with other substances, and under conditions which differ from EN 374, contact the supplier of the EC approved gloves.

πŸ‘οΈ Eye Protection

If splashes are likely to occur, wear :. Safety glasses with side-shields.

😷 Respiratory Protection

When workers are facing concentrations above the exposure limit they must use appropriate certified respirators. Respirator with combination filter for vapour/particulate (EN 141). The use of breathing apparatus must comply strictly with the manufacturer's instructions and the regulations governing their choices and uses.

🦺 Skin/Body Protection

Wear suitable protective clothing. Protective shoes or boots. Long sleeved clothing.

🌍 Environmental Exposure Controls

The product should not be allowed to enter drains, water courses or the soil
